  5. I've connected a card access relay to a fireplace so that it can turn it on and off through programming. The annoying thing is that there's still a low voltage standard light switch that can be used to manually turn the fireplace on as well. The problem is if it's manually turned on with the light switch then the card access relay can't turn the fireplace off. So what I've done is I've removed the light switch and put a 2-button relay in its place, and disconnected the low voltage wires. The intent is for the 2-button relay to command the cardaccess relay to open or close. I'd like the 2-button relay to behave like a normal light switch as well. So when the fireplace is on I want the top LED to be Blue and the bottom LED off. Vice versa if the fireplace is off. I had assumed I could just bind the 2-button keypad to the card access relay in the same way you can bind it to another C4 dimmer. That doesn't appear to be possible though. I get the feeling I'm missing a step here.

  7. So I'm on 2.10.6. I have three HC-250s in my project and Gen2 echos. If I'm understanding correctly, I have to upgrade to 3.0 in order to get my Gen2 echos to work again? In order to upgrade to 3.0 I have to replace all three of my HC-250s to EA series controllers. As I understand it, HC-250s are not allowed in software version 3.0. I suspect upgrading to 3.0 will cost well over $1000, and all that just so that I can get my echos to work again. or buy gen1 echos. Or...wait until your partner updates the driver to work with 2.10.6. Has he made any progress on this?

  12. I have a system on 2.10.6. There are many wireless dimmers that are model LDZ-101 and LDZ-102 in the system and operating properly. I'm having trouble adding an additional LDZ-102 to the project and I've just noticed that its driver is found under the "Discontinued Products" section. Does this mean that, even though there are existing and properly functioning wireless dimmers, it's not possible to add new wireless dimmers? Each time I add the wireless dimmer the project it fails to validate and indicates that its binding is conflicting with the binding of some other device or simply that it's not bound at all.
